Address

mona1qt4mzrn0xpsxaaq86rng8zrat9zakce5yr3wwu2

32.84592548 MONA
11.36 USD

Confirmed
Total Received32.84592548 MONA11.36 USD
Total Sent0 MONA0.00 USD
Final Balance32.84592548 MONA11.36 USD
No. Transactions1

Transactions

PKh6LpVDVSxccx5KuPwPLutkgGQGDU4iSS94.024 MONA272.84 USD32.51 USD
 
mona1qt4mzrn0xpsxaaq86rng8zrat9zakce5yr3wwu232.84592548 MONA95.31 USD11.36 USD×
MTJtz3Q47nvSwKWqnDeZ3tPzsjAy7zcs8761.17790752 MONA177.53 USD21.15 USD